Preface
The purpose of this publication is to provide the service
technician with information for troubleshooting, testing
and repair of major systems and components on the
Greensmaster 3150 (Model 04358).

    What to do if hydraulic fluid foams in my Toro Greensmaster 3150?
    • D
      Donna ThomasAug 26, 2025
      If the hydraulic fluid in your Toro Lawn Mower is foaming, it could be due to several reasons. First, check the hydraulic reservoir oil level and refill to the correct level if it's low. Secondly, ensure that the hydraulic system has the correct type of oil and replace it if necessary. Lastly, inspect the pump suction line for any air leaks and repair them.

    Why is my Toro Lawn Mower traction response sluggish?
    • R
      Rebecca DoughertyAug 26, 2025
      A sluggish traction response in your Toro Lawn Mower can be attributed to several factors. If the hydraulic oil is very cold, allow it to warm up before operating. Check that the brakes are released or correctly adjusted. Additionally, the piston pump by-pass valve may be open or defective, requiring repair or replacement. Low charge pressure can also cause this, so perform a Charge Pressure Relief Valve Pressure Test and adjust the charge pressure. Leaking or damaged piston (traction) pump relief valves, or worn or damaged piston (traction) pump or wheel motor(s) can also be the cause, so they should be repaired or replaced.

    What to do if my Toro Greensmaster 3150 Lawn Mower's cutting units will not lift or lift slowly?
    • M
      Michael SpencerAug 27, 2025
      If the cutting units on your Toro Lawn Mower are not lifting or are lifting slowly, several factors could be responsible. Start by increasing the engine speed. Check the hydraulic reservoir oil level and refill if low. Inspect and repair any binding or broken lift cylinder linkage, or replace binding or worn lift cylinder bushings. Perform a Charge Relief Valve Pressure Test and adjust charge circuit pressure if it is low. Replace or repair a leaking or damaged implement relief valve or hydraulic manifold solenoid valve (S2), as well as a leaking or damaged relief valve (R2). Inspect and repair internal leaks in lift cylinders, repair a hung spool in the steering control valve, or replace or repair a worn or damaged rear section of the gear pump.

    Why are regular adjustments to my Toro Lawn Mower steering wheel necessary?
    • L
      Lynn HarrisSep 4, 2025
      If you find yourself constantly adjusting the steering wheel of your Toro Lawn Mower because of difficulty driving in a straight line, the leaf springs in the steering control valve might be worn or broken, requiring replacement. Alternatively, the gear wheel set in the steering control valve could be worn and in need of replacement. A seized steering cylinder or worn piston seals are other potential causes, so repair the cylinder or replace the seals.
